Now, before we get into the fundamentals of how you can watch 'The Name of the Rose' right now, here are some specifics about the Cristaldifilm, Les Films Ariane, ZDF, RAI, Constantin Film mystery flick.
Released September 24th, 1986, 'The Name of the Rose' stars Sean Connery, F. Murray Abraham, Christian Slater, Helmut Qualtinger The R movie has a runtime of about 2 hr 10 min, and received a user score of 75 (out of 100) on TMDb, which assembled reviews from 2,844 top users.
Interested in knowing what the movie's about? Here's the plot: "14th-century Franciscan monk William of Baskerville and his young novice arrive at a conference to find that several monks have been murdered under mysterious circumstances. To solve the crimes, William must rise up against the Church's authority and fight the shadowy conspiracy of monastery monks using only his intelligence – which is considerable."
